Bain Capital appoints advisers for Bugaboo exit

Bain Capital has mandated Robert W. Baird and Barclays Capital to sell Dutch pram developer Bugaboo International, according to two sources familiar with the situation.

Hg appoints advisers for IRIS Software auction

IRIS Software majority owner Hg has appointed Goldman Sachs and Arma Partners to advise on an upcoming sale of the business, two sources familiar with the situation said.

Livingbridge taps PwC to explore Helping Hands exit

Private equity firm Livingbridge has hired PwC to explore a sale of its British home care business Helping Hands, according to two sources familiar with the situation.

Sovereign Capital readies Nurse Plus for exit

Sovereign Capital has hired Clearwater International to explore a sale of UK-based healthcare staff agency Nurse Plus, two sources familiar with the situation said.
